New Delhi. Shoaib Akhtar has said a big thing about the semi-final match played between India and Pakistan in the 2011 Cricket World Cup. On 30 March 2011, the second semi-final between India and Pakistan was played in Mohali. It was a matter of happiness for India that Team India won this match by 29 runs and entered the final. After that India was also successful in winning the World Cup title. On the other hand, the sad thing for Pakistan was that they lost a big chance to win the World Cup. Former Pakistan fast bowler Shoaib Akhtar remembers this semi-final match a lot.
Shoaib Akhtar was not included in Pakistan’s playing XI in this semi-final played between India and Pakistan. He was declared unfit before this great match. Talking to Sportskeeda, Shoaib Akhtar reminisced about the Mohali semi-final. He said that what the team management did to me was unfair.
Shoaib Akhtar further said, ‘The memory of Mohali semi-final bothers me. I should have played. Should have fed them. This was totally unfair on the part of the team management. I knew I had only 2 matches left. I wish that the flag of Pakistan should be high in Wankhede and the team plays the finals. I knew India was under a lot of pressure. The whole country and media was looking at him. That’s why I believed that we don’t have to take pressure.
Sachin-Sehwag gets out
Shoaib Akhtar said, ‘I knew the first 10 overs of the match would make a big difference. Had he been a part of the team, he would have dismissed leading batsmen including Indian team batsman Sachin Tendulkar, Virender Sehwag. The former bowler recalled the pain of watching his team lose the match in the dug-out. Shoaib Akhtar said, ‘He was so disappointed for not playing that he broke some things in the dressing room.’

India won the match by 29 runs
Batting first in this semi-final match, India scored 260 runs for 9 wickets. For India, Sachin Tendulkar scored 85, Virender Sehwag scored 38 and Suresh Raina scored 36 runs. Wahab Riaz took the maximum 5 wickets for Pakistan. Chasing the target of 261 runs for victory, Pakistan’s team was all out for 231 runs in 49.5 overs. In this way the Indian team won this match by 29 runs.
